Senior QA Engineer Job Description

senior qa engineer job description includes a detailed overview of the key requirements, duties, responsibilities, and skills for this role.

Last update : July 14, 2023

Senior QA Engineer Job Description

A senior QA engineer is a technical quality engineer that possesses advanced knowledge and experience in testing and QA.

A senior QA engineer typically has 10+ years of experience working in a QA role, specifically in a testing or test management role.

A senior QA engineer has experience with diverse QA methodologies, such as Agile, Waterfall, and Lean.

A senior QA engineer typically reports into the quality assurance director or manager.

A senior level QA engineer is familiar with various types of testing, such as unit testing, component testing, integration testing, system testing, acceptance testing

Job Brief:

We’re looking for a Senior QA Engineer to join our team. As a Senior QA Engineer, you will be responsible for leading the quality assurance effort for our products. You will be working closely with our development team to ensure that our products meet the highest quality standards. If you are a detail-oriented problem solver with a passion for quality, we want to hear from you!

Senior QA Engineer Duties:

  • Provide technical expertise on quality assurance and quality control
  • Supervise quality assurance engineers
  • Coordinate and execute projects, including setting up process flows, identifying and documenting potential issues, generating testing strategies, developing and maintaining test scripts, and providing valuable QA feedback to developers
  • Analyze product and process specifications and procedures
  • Identify and recommend major improvements to procedural and business processes
  • Develop quality assurance standards and processes
  • Perform other duties as assigned

Senior QA Engineer Responsibilities:

  • Recommend changes or improvements to existing processes, methods, and technologies that improve product quality, safety, productivity, and customer satisfaction
  • Develop and conduct test plans and test cases, including test scripts, results, execution, shared responsibilities, deadlines and test environment
  • Implement test plans and test cases, and supervise inspections and testing of components, sub-assemblies, or for packaged software
  • Develop test cases based on requirements and implement test plans to assure software meets project specifications and design
  • Perform exploratory testing with a focus on identifying and documenting defects
  • Review defects and test logs to identify root causes and suggest solutions for improving testing, documentation, and process improvement
  • Perform research and write new test cases
  • Document test data and results
  • Understand product lifecycle concepts and participate in the test planning process
  • Provide training to junior engineers

Requirements And Skills:

  • Bachelor’s degree in engineering or related field
  • 2+ years’ proven experience as an QA Engineer in a fast-paced environment
  • Expert knowledge of technical design processes, flowcharting techniques, and code compliance
  • Strong attention to detail
  • Ability to balance the scope of large projects while managing

[Company Name] is committed to building a workplace that reflects the rich diversity of our community. We are an Equal Opportunity Employer that welcomes applications from people of all races, religions, national origins, genders, and ages.


Share this article :

Looking for a job? Prepare for interviews here!

  • Free Reports
  • No credit card required
Related Job Descriptions